The next step is to minimize, not completely eliminate, dairy. What I mean by this is, stay away from drinking milk, eating cereal with milk, eating yogurt etc. Things like cheeseburgers, cheesesteaks, toasted cheese etc., are perfectly fine! I still eat all those things and never have any issue with tonsil stones anymore. Stay away from anything dairy that’s liquid, or can get into your tonsil crypts easily. You’re essentially trying to minimize the amount of dairy that finds its way inside your tonsils, and liquid obviously does the most damage.
